SOLO Tip of the Week:

Don't ignore what you love about your job.

Is there an element of your job that you absolutely love to do? If so, is there a way to develop that further? Could you hire someone to do other parts of the job that you don't enjoy so that you could focus more on the parts that you do love? Could you coach others on what you love to do?

Whatever it is, don't ignore your passions. When you are operating at peak passion, you are giving your best to those around you, and you will radiate.
